Think about what you’re saying…
BEFORE you say it.
I’m not just talking about our words either.
As coaches and volunteers, we need to make sure we are communicating respectfully and inclusively in every way.
-verbally
-body language
-facial expressions
We need to be aware of how we are communicating with all of these avenues, and reflect to make sure we are not making inappropriate assumptions and stepping in when our assistance is not wanted or needed.
It’s our role to support the athlete at every stage, the way they want to be supported.

Inclusive communication is essential when working with athletes, especially in adaptive sports and disability inclusion settings. Beyond the words we say, being mindful of our body language and facial expressions is crucial to ensure respect and create a supportive environment. One important approach is focusing on ability rather than limitations. By highlighting what someone can do instead of emphasizing challenges or using pitying language, we reinforce dignity and encourage confidence. Another critical aspect is always asking before offering help. Often, good intentions lead to unsolicited assistance, which can feel intrusive or disempowering. Asking first shows respect for personal autonomy and helps build trust between coaches, volunteers, and athletes. Reflecting regularly on how we communicate can help identify unconscious biases or assumptions that may undermine inclusivity. Listening actively and embracing feedback from athletes ensures that support aligns with their preferences and needs at every stage. Incorporating inclusive language and respectful behavior fosters a positive and empowering environment that benefits everyone. By thinking carefully about how we express ourselves through words and non-verbal cues, we model the inclusivity that adaptive sports communities strive for. Ultimately, this thoughtful communication contributes to better teamwork, higher motivation, and a stronger sense of belonging for all participants.
